APPLICANTS MUST HAVE PRIOR EXPERIENCE IN BIOTECH, PHARMACEUTICAL, OR ANIMAL HEALTH INDUSTRIES TO BE CONSIDERED Essential Duties: • Execute GMP Proscenterliningmethodologyacross all phases: scope and readiness (Phase 0), evaluate and define (Phase 1), refine and execute (Phase 2), and assess and solidify (Phase 3)., • Conduct equipment and process readiness assessments: inventory line count, machine count, mechanical and electronic adjustment points, changeover formats, and available performance data (OEE, downtime, changeover time)., • Perform Phase 1 documentation reviews: cross-reference OEM manuals, equipment SOPs, PM records, qualification documents, batch tickets, and work instructions toidentifygaps and confirm equipment state., • Conduct operator and maintenance interviews and on-floor observations to capture machine quirks, setup practices, undocumented knowledge, and current-state culture., • Develop master adjustment listsidentifyingall process-critical adjustment points per machine and SKU, including mechanical and electronic settings with current and target values., • Design and execute Design of Experiments (DOEs) for CPP confirmation defining measurements, intervals, sample sizes, success criteria, and adjustment sequencing to optimize centerline parameters., • Create centerline documentation: control plans, point-of-use labeling, SOP updates, and change management tracking forms aligned to client document systems., • Drive changeover reduction using structured methods (SMED or equivalent): analyze current changeover procedures,identifywaste and variability, and implement standard changeover SOPs with measurable improvement., • Lead or support Phase 3 audit activities: review change controls, deviations, calibration schedules, training records, and adjustment point integrity; generate audit reports with findings and recommended corrective actions., • Establish andfacilitatecenterline review cadences (weekly/bi-weekly) with client operations, maintenance, and engineering teams, covering OEE, changeover data, downtime trends, and centerline change review., • Support identification and development of client-side centerline champions to sustain the program after GMP Pros engagement concludes., • Partner with QA, Maintenance, Operations, and Engineering to keep packaging lines controlled, compliant, and execution-ready in accordance with client GMP requirements.
